Akali
Most Akali's have trouble actually poking you out of lane. Avoid trades and just look to farm. Once you are 6 you should be able to farm pretty easily. Her shroud will prevent you from auto'ing her, so play around it.
Camille
You have to dodge her E. If you can do that consistently, then you should be fine. If the Camille is good, she will predict your dodge and you are just in a 50/50 chance of dying whenever her E is off cooldown. You have to sit really far back in the lane to stay out of her E range.
Cho'Gath
Just dodge his Q by using your W. A well-timed ult can block his R and you can just chop him down. Once you have Bork you can just kill him. If he build AP then you can kill him as soon as you are 6.
Darius
Skill matchup. Early ganks are great since Darius players tend to be so aggressive. If you can manage to get him to blow his Flash or Ghost early then he loses all kill pressure on you and you can just kite him. Once you are 6 and have bork you should be able to kill him pretty easily. You can also use your ult to block his Q heal to ensure a kill.
Dr. Mundo
Hard to kill and hard to kite. He doesn't have too much damage to all-in you and just kill you. Mostly a farm lane which is the benefit to you. By playing around his cleavers and preventing him from getting too fed early you are much more impactful during teamfights.
Fiora
Skill matchup. You have to play around her vitals. Many Fiora's will W+Q to get the slow and AA slow from range, so watch out for that. Make sure your Jungler doesn't CC her into the parry of else she can pretty easily win 1v2.
Gangplank
Gangplank is pretty weak right now, but his poke is still very potent. If you walk up to farm and take too many of his Q's you are going to have to back too many times to get any levels or farm. Play away from bushes as GP's like to leave barrels in there to chain together.
Garen
Very kitable. Make sure you save your Q until after he uses his Q. If you agressively use your Q he can cancel the slow and get on you pretty easily. His R is very telegraphed and you can use your R to block the damage. If you do this it should be pretty easy for you.
Gnar
On paper this should be a bad matchup, but Gnar's tend not to really have much impact. As long as you dodge his Q's and don't walk up too far he has trouble sticking on to you. If he is playing aggressive bait out his W on to you and any gank will ruin him.
Gragas
Dodge Gragas E. If you do that he has no way to build up his Q damage. If he takes phase rush he has no way to really kill you, and if he takes anything else you can kite him really easily.
Illaoi
Once you are 6 you can kill her tentacles from range and she loses a lot of her ability to bully her. Make sure to dodge her E. If she uses R and is about to heal from the tentacle smack, use your R to prevent the damage as it will also prevent the healing.
Irelia
Play around her passive stacks. Once she is at 5 stacks you have to play way back to prevent her from Q'ing to a minion to get to you. Once she is 6 she will almost certainly try and all in, so call for a gank once that is about to happen.
Jax
Skill matchup. Once he uses his Q on to you, try and Q him in mid-air. If you do this properly you can W and dodge his stun. If this situation happens you can then start beating on him with autos. Watch out for his passive early. The attack speed steroid for him makes him much stronger.
Jayce
He is a lane bully and you have to play far back. If he ever gets in range to jump on you in hammer form you are going to just die. Beg for ganks and hope he is bad.
Kayle
Why are you playing norms?
There are no tiny threats to Kayle in lane. You lose pretty much everything pre-6.
Kennen
You have very little kill pressure on him, but if you play passive then he doesn't have much kill pressure on you either. Use your R to block the 3rd hit from his R as this is most likely when kennen will cast his Q on you as well.
Kled
He can and should dive you. If their jungler is anywhere near topside you have to be careful. You can only walk up past 6 if you have both flash and your R off CD. Otherwise you are just going to get dove.
Lucian
Not too common anymore, but still a very dangerous lane. Beg for ganks and try to bait out an aggressive E by him. If you can do that he will have no more mobility and you should be able to kill with help of your jungler.
Malphite
I perma-ban this champion right now. If he build AP he will just poke you out with Q and one-shot you out of nowhere. If he builds tank you will never kill him and he will still one-shot you.
Maokai
Maokai doesn't have too much kill pressure on your early, but he can continually W on to you and just be annoying. Farm up and wait for teamfights and you will be much more useful.
Mordekaiser
Use your W to dodge his E and you win every fight. He has no way to get on top of you and once you finish Bork you can easily 1v1 him. If you are having trouble build wits end and you will crush him.
Nasus
This is the only matchup I walk up and trade lvl 1. Walk try and proc PTA and get as many auto's off on him and then spam E on him every time it is off CD to keep him low. If he is smart as soon as he is 6 he will have 2 points in wither and just kill you.
Ornn
Try your best to dodge his Q as he will be able to poke you pretty hard with it. Stay far away when his W is off CD as the brittle proc+grasp will chunk you really hard.
Renekton
This is a matchup you need early assistance. If your jungler is weak early (like yi) then you are double screwed as Renekton can pretty easily 1v2 you if he takes ignite. You have to play really far back as his E range allows him to bully almost all of the lane. If you play far enough back his main combo will be E+E+W+AA+Q. After this combo he will have nothing off of CD so you can then bully him pretty hard.
Rengar
Play on the bottom part of the lane and keep a deep ward to watch for ganks. As long as you know his jump range you are pretty safe and he won't have much of an ability to kill you. Use your R as he is jumping on you from his R and he won't have any kill pressure for awhile.
Riven
She has tons of mobility so you can't kite her easily and she does tons of damage. Once you are 6 you can play pretty safe and poke her down with auto's safely. As long as she doesn't get fed you hard outscale and will carry teamfights.
Rumble
His early base dmg is incredibly high, but as long as you play safe early he won't be able to build much of a lead. His ultimate is team-fight deciding, so your team has to play around it and not clump. Other than that, once you are 6 you should be able to just kite and kill him pretty easily.
Sett
His level 1-3 is pretty dangerous and he may flash on your early to get first-blood. Once you have Bork you can kite him. Use your Q to slow him when he uses his Q to try and get on you and you should be able to chunk him. Use your W to dodge the true dmg from his W.
Shen
On paper this should be a horrible matchup. Hard CC to lock you down and keep you from using R. Mass AA-blocking. Good early dueler. I am honestly not sure why, but Shen always seems to fall off and be useless later. As long as you are safe and make it to the mid-game he won't ever kill you and you can kite him all day long.
Singed
Very difficult to kite. Try and play far back and don't let him get free E's on you. As long as you make it out of lane safely, your impact on teamfights will be much more than his.
Sion
Only thing to really note is don't walk near bushes level 1. Most Sion's will wait there and try and Cheese you with a fully charged Q. Other than that he really can never kill you. Use your W to dodge his E in lane and keep it up while he is backed to help dodge his R.
Teemo
He will likely be invis in lane level 1, so sit as far back until he shows to grab his first minion. Teemo usually takes ignite, so he can majorly burn you. He has incredible early kill potential, so play far back. Buy sweeper early and buy tons of control wards. Try and use your lifesteal to make it through the lane and then during teamfights try and target him down so he can't continually block you AA's with his blind.
Tryndamere
Watch out for early Cheese. If he has lethal tempo + ignite you have to sit back to avoid getting first blooded. His ulti is better than you in the 1v1 and if you aren't careful will let him dive you. Building an early stopwatch can really mess him up as it allows you to wait out his ulti.
Urgot
The only way he will ever get on to you is if he flash+W. If you can avoid this then you can kite him all day long. He slows himself with his W and you can also block his R with your R as long as you time it correctly. The timing is pretty specific, but if you play this matchup enough you will learn it.
Wukong
He can jump on you, make you waste PTA on his clone, and the extra armor he gets from his passive makes you do very little damage to him. Beg for ganks and cry.
Yorick
You have to dodge his E. As long as you do, you can auto all of his minions with range once you are 6 and it will be super easily to kill him. If you get hit by E you probably will die or burn your flash. It is honestly better to flash his E than get hit by it and have to flash his box. Dodge E -> you win.

There are almost no matchups that you win in lane pre-6. When in lane you are looking to be passive, farm at range with E and go in for minions only when the enemy laner cannot punish you for it. If your jungler invades, you CANNOT help him. You will lose every 2v2 because you are that weak. If you get invaded and are pushed under tower with a huge wave, it is better to get the CS and get the levels ahead on your laner. If your laner TP's bot then you should push in the wave and get as much CS and tower platings as you can. The only times you fight in lane is when you have a large wave with your passive stacked up, or if you are taking bad trades to set up for a gank. Pre-6 you will just die to pretty much every toplaner in a 1v1.
Levels 6-10
Once you hit level 6 you can start to fight. Grab yourselves your berserker's greaves and attempt to kite. You can now safely poke in most matchups. AA+AA+E is the best way for quick damage and to proc PTA. By doing this over and over your E damage will gradually increase and start to chunk your laner. Just keep doing this until your laner has to back. Keep farming and if you can set up a gank with your jungler, you can usually dive pretty safely with your R. If you are finishing your Bork as they finish their first item, you won lane and can start to really bully.
Levels 11-15.
Once you hit 11 and you are not significantly behind, you will be able to solo-kill them. Your waveclear is now very strong, and they will have to bring 2 people top to stop your split. Keep good vision in the jungle and watch out for them bringing people top to kill you. If you are top and there are no other objectives on the map, you are not acomplishing much, wait until dragon spawns to push hard. Keep up your TP and watch for teamfights where you can TP and ult the carry to win the fight. Otherwise do your best to farm to 16.
Late game
If you made it to level 16 and your team isn't significantly behind, you win the game. You can single-handedly carry fights. Your DPS will be insane, but you still have to be careful not to be CC chained. Stopwatch, GA, and playing around your R will keep you safe. You can shred Baron and all tanks. Make sure your team plays around you, and you will win the game.
